I began my professional journey by graduating in human medicine in Zagreb, but life had other plans. Love brought me to Germany, where new challenges awaited. Amid the competitive landscape following the Berlin Wall’s fall, I pursued dentistry at LMU Munich while raising a young child.

A pivotal moment came during my oral surgery residency under Dr. Dr. Achim Herrmann, who introduced me to the transformative power of education in dentistry.

The true turning point came during Bob Lamb’s soft tissue course 25 years ago, when he asked: “Do you want me to make you a great periodontist?” That moment reshaped my life.

I began approaching each case as a periodontist, preserving tissue whenever possible and using my oral surgery toolbox to rebuild tissue when needed.

Over 25 years, I’ve performed countless surgeries in the aesthetic zone, published original techniques in peer-reviewed journals, and mentored dentists who have become accomplished clinicians and educators.

Today, alongside my husband (yes, the boyfriend who brought me to Germany) and our son Marko, who recently joined my educational company, I focus on what I love most: diagnosis, planning, surgeries, and mentoring.

Rooted in my childhood creativity and shaped by mentors who saw my potential before I did, I now strive to inspire others.

As Bob Proctor said: “A mentor is someone who sees more talent and ability within you than you see in yourself and helps bring it out of you.” That is the spirit I bring to every patient, every lecture, and every mentorship.

Dr. Dr. Snjezana Pohl

Founder
  • 1987 - 1990Croatia and Germany

    Work experience in general surgery, orthopedics.

  • 1997 - 2010Starnberg, Germany

    Praxisklinik for Oral and Maxillofacial Surgery Dr.Dr.Herrmann & Dr.Dr.Pohl

  • 2010 - presentRijeka, Croatia

    Dental Clinics Rident. Head of Oral Surgery Department

  • 2011 - presentOral Medicine & Periodontology Dept,
    Faculty of Medicine, Rijeka, Croatia

    Clinical Assistant Professor

Education

University Zagreb, Croatia, Dr. med.

1987

Ludwig Maximillian University, Munich, Germany, Dentist

1997

Doctor degree, University of Cologne, Dr. med. dent.

2002

European Dental Association: Expert for Periodontology

2002

Oral Surgery Specialist, Munich

2003

European Dental Association: Expert for Implantology

2010
